Plano YMCA Kickoff Campaign Tops Fifteen Thousand
Don Griffin announced at the Vines High School banquet that the Plano YMCA sustaining campaign has raised 15 225 in pledges with 11 455 in cash. Over 100 workers attended as Griffin polled the ten divisions about the drive.

City National Bank of Plano gains preliminary OCC approval
Preliminary approval granted by the U S Comptroller of Currency for City National Bank of Plano to operate at the southeast corner of FM 544 and Independence Parkway with a proposed capitalization of 1 5 million. Organizers/directors include County Judge Nathan E White Jr and Norman F Whitsitt among Plano residents. operation planned in a few months.

Plano P Z Commission approves SF 3 rezoning on 52.2 acre tract
Plano planning board backs SF 3 zoning for a 52.2 acre northwest site and expects nearby land to follow SF 2. Two members oppose lower zoning. A separate 213 acre tract is endorsed for SF 3, and various other plats and replat approvals are granted including a duplex request denial and several commercial and school developments.

County OKs Agenda Items At Meeting
Collin County commissioners approved a three member committee of the district judge county judge and county court at law judge to decide courthouse closings during icy weather and to notify radio and TV stations. They also approved a $18731.44 utility adjustment with North Farmersville Water Supply Corp on Highway 78. Holiday closings for 1977 were set with Mondays Fridays or weekends common. A bond for Gates Steen delinquent tax attorney was approved and minutes from the prior meeting were approved. The court adjourned into executive session to consider appointments to Collin Memorial Hospital and postponed them to next week.

Plane Home Damaged By Kitchen Fire
A Saturday night kitchen fire caused considerable damage to the John Nicolaisen home at 2613 Charter Oaks with smoke and heat damage throughout. Fire Marshal Bill Threet said firefighters contained the blaze to the kitchen after five units and 16 men worked from 8:12 to 8:28 p.m. No dollar loss estimate was provided and the cause remains undetermined.

Jury Selection Underway in Capital Murder Case
Jury selection begins in the capital murder case against Greg Henry accused of shooting deaths of Kenneth Avery and Lynn Studds near Plano on Sept. 26. Case presided by Judge Tom Ryan with DA Tom O Connell and defense attorneys overseeing proceedings.

Texas Power & Light rate hike suspended by Texas utility panel
The Public Utility Commission of Texas suspended TP&L’s requested rate increase for at least 120 days. Filed December 22 with an effective date January 26, a public hearing is set for March 1. Cities in TP&L's service area may also suspend the date under PURA.
